Factors Influencing Cost
Residential kitchen remodeling in Grand Prairie, TX, involves updating and enhancing the primary cooking and food preparation space. Projects can vary widely based on scope, materials, and design preferences, providing options suitable for different budgets and needs.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ners plan effectively and compare options.
- Materials: Choices include granite, quartz, laminate, or tile countertops, with varying costs and durability.
- Size and Scope: Ranges from minor updates like cabinet repainting to full-scale renovations involving layout changes.
- Labor Complexity: Projects may involve simple installations or more intricate tasks such as custom cabinetry or plumbing modifications.
- Permitting: Some projects require permits from local authorities, especially when structural changes or electrical updates are involved.
- Extras: Additional features like new appliances, lighting upgrades, or custom backsplashes can increase overall project scope and costs.
